The Thailand Swine Vaccines Market is experiencing steady growth driven by increasing awareness about the benefits of vaccination in preventing swine diseases. Key factors contributing to market growth include the rising demand for pork products, government initiatives to control and eradicate diseases in swine populations, and a growing focus on animal health and welfare. Major players in the market are investing in research and development to introduce innovative vaccines that offer better protection against various diseases. The market is characterized by a competitive landscape with companies such as Zoetis, Merck Animal Health, and Ceva Animal Health leading the way. With a growing emphasis on preventive healthcare in the swine industry, the Thailand Swine Vaccines Market is expected to continue its expansion in the coming years.

The Thailand Swine Vaccines Market faces several challenges, including the prevalence of counterfeit or substandard vaccines, limited awareness and education among farmers about the importance of vaccination, and the lack of proper infrastructure for vaccine distribution and storage in rural areas. Additionally, the high cost of vaccines and the economic constraints of small-scale farmers pose barriers to widespread adoption. Regulatory issues and the need for more research and development to address emerging diseases further complicate the market landscape. Overall, addressing these challenges will require collaboration between government agencies, vaccine manufacturers, veterinary professionals, and farmers to improve vaccination practices and ensure the health and productivity of Thailand`s swine industry.

The Thailand government has implemented various policies related to the swine vaccines market to ensure the health and safety of livestock and consumers. The Department of Livestock Development (DLD) is responsible for overseeing the registration, production, and distribution of swine vaccines in the country. They have set strict guidelines and regulations for vaccine manufacturers to adhere to, to guarantee the quality and efficacy of the products. Additionally, the government provides subsidies and support to encourage farmers to vaccinate their swine herds, aiming to control the spread of diseases and improve overall animal welfare. The government also conducts regular monitoring and inspection activities to enforce compliance with the regulations and maintain a transparent and efficient market for swine vaccines in Thailand.
